3. [6 points] A 2-m-long center-fed dipole antenna operates in the AM broadcast
band at 1 MHz. The dipole is made of copper wire with a radius of 1 mm.
(a) Determine the radiation efficiency of the antenna.
(b) What is the antenna gain in dB?
(c) What antenna current is required so that the antenna would radiate 80 W,
and how much power will the generator have to supply to the antenna?
4. [4 points] The directivity of an antenna pattern is given by the following equation:
D , Do sin 3
(a) What should the value of the constant Do be in order to be a valid
directivity?
(b) What is the half power beamwidth of this antenna?
